Important

What to Know Before You Buy

Cat-Back Coverage

The 2002–2010 Dodge Ram is cat-back only — no axle-back systems are marketed. A cat-back replaces the mid-pipe and mufflers from the catalytic converter back. Full performance gain, 50-state emissions legal. Improves towing and throttle response.

Year Range & Body Style

2002–2008 is the third-gen Ram; 2009–2010 is the fourth-gen. Exhaust routing differs by year and cab/bed. MBRP 2003 fits Reg/Crew short bed only. JBA fits 2006–2018 Quad Cab 5.7L. Flowmaster American Thunder fits 2009–2018. Verify fitment before ordering.

Materials: 304 vs 409 vs Aluminized

304 stainless is most corrosion-resistant. 409 stainless is a step up from aluminized. Aluminized is budget-friendly; expect shorter life in salt climates. AWE, Gibson, and MagnaFlow offer 304; Flowmaster and aFe use 409 or aluminized.

Single vs Dual Exit

Single side-exit (behind rear tire) is common. Dual exit (side or rear) adds a more aggressive look. AWE 0FG offers dual rear exit. aFe offers single and dual. JBA and MBRP use single exit.

Common Questions

Frequently Asked Questions

Why are there no axle-back options for the 2002–2010 Ram?

The 2002–2010 Dodge Ram is a truck platform; manufacturers typically offer cat-back systems. Axle-backs are not commonly marketed. A cat-back provides the full performance and sound upgrade, and improves towing and throttle response.

Will an aftermarket exhaust void my warranty?

Cat-back systems install behind the factory catalytic converters and do not affect emissions equipment. They generally do not void the vehicle warranty. Modifications that alter emissions can affect warranty. Check with your dealer if concerned.

Do exhaust systems improve towing?

Yes. Cat-back systems reduce backpressure and improve exhaust flow, which can improve low-end torque and throttle response. Gibson and Flowmaster market their Ram systems for towing and hill climbing. Expect modest gains (5–15 HP / lb-ft).

What causes exhaust drone and how do I avoid it?

Drone is resonance at certain RPMs that amplifies inside the cabin. Aggressive mufflers can increase drone. AWE 180 Technology®, Gibson, MBRP Tour Profile, and Flowmaster FloxFX are tuned for minimal interior drone. Research sound clips before buying.

Stainless vs aluminized: which is better?

304 stainless is more corrosion-resistant and premium. 409 stainless is a step up from aluminized. Aluminized is budget-friendly; expect shorter life in salt climates.
